[email protected] Abstract. In recent years, a structural transformation of the manufacturing indus- try has been occurring as a result of the digital revolution. Thus, digital tools are now systematically used throughout the entire value chain, from design to produc- tion to marketing, especially virtual and augmented reality. Therefore, the purpose of this paper is to review, through concrete use cases, the progress of these novel technologies and their use in the manufacturing industry.
